To start with, first ask yourself why you want to photograph this or that particular subject, and what you want to express in your image.ĭon’t try to say too much. To create unity in your images you should have a clear idea of what kind of story you are trying to communicate. So, you should always look for a balance between unity and variety. On the other hand, variety adds interest and energy to an image, but the addition of too much variety makes your image chaotic and difficult to understand. However, too much unity can be dull and lifeless. It is useful to know that unity adds order to an image. They are working together to reinforce your message. ![]() Through unity, the elements of your image are not competing with each other for attention. The idea behind the principle of unity is to create an image where all elements support each other and all work together toward a common goal – to express your intended message. This happens when the principle of unity is used to create a photograph. You might have noticed, when looking at photographs, that the real visual excitement comes when an image has harmonic unity, giving you a satisfying sense of belonging and a relationship between all elements. If your cake needs a teaspoon of vanilla extract, then add half a teaspoon of cinnamon powder instead. You can use cinnamon with any types of desserts in lieu of vanilla extract. Pure goodness to wake you up and start the day right. ![]() The aroma of coffee and cinnamon, when mixed together, is so divine, especially for a warm morning cup. It just levels up that regular caffeine treat and gives it a special touch to it. 2 tbsps of the cinnamon extract can replace ½ teaspoon of cinnamon powder. Just in case you only have a cinnamon bark instead, you can process it in a food processor to turn it into a powder or boil it in a cup of water for at least an hour to extract its aroma and juices. There’s no need to dilute the cinnamon powder. If you need more, then just tweak the measurements and make it your own. The safest ratio you can start with is ½ teaspoon of cinnamon over 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ract. So depending on the dessert or pastry you’re making, you should start with half a teaspoon or so. Consider that cinnamon is a bit stronger than vanilla extract when it comes to taste and aroma.
